Aktueller Inhalt von Bernard

  1. Bernard

    TIA Direkter Zugriff auf einzelne Komponenten von DT

    Super, und da das Programm schon mal aus der S5 Welt nach S7 konvertiert wurde gibt es endlich wieder Schmiermerker und natürlich alles in AWL. Zurück zu den Wurzel alles Andere ist nur neumodischer Unsinn. Ach ich hatte ja die schönen S5-Timer und Zähler vergessen, was war 1979 doch für eine...
  2. Bernard

    TIA Direkter Zugriff auf einzelne Komponenten von DT

    Hier die Beschreibung des optimierten Zugriffs von Siemens. https://support.industry.siemens.com/cs/document/67655611/welche-zugriffsarten-gibt-es-in-step-7-(tia-portal)-um-auf-datenwerte-in-bausteine-zuzugreifen-und-welche-unterschiede-zwischen-diesen-m%C3%BCssen-sie-beachten-?dti=0&lc=de-DE...
  3. Bernard

    TIA Direkter Zugriff auf einzelne Komponenten von DT

    Auch jeder FC hat temporäre Daten, also eigenen Speicher, deshalb kann man auch hier optimiert bzw. nicht optimiert arbeiten. Viele Grüße Bernard
  4. Bernard

    TIA Direkter Zugriff auf einzelne Komponenten von DT

    Ablauf zwischen nicht optimierten/optimierten Bausteinen. Daten aus einem nicht optimierten Speicherbereich werden über dem Lokaldatenstack des aufrufenden Bausteinen in den optimierten Speicherbereich gekoppelt. Das verbraucht natürlich Zeit und könnte auch zu einem Stacküberlauf führen( eher...
  5. Bernard

    TIA Direkter Zugriff auf einzelne Komponenten von DT

    der Ersatz für Adresspointer jedweder Art heißt Variant und hat keinen Bezug auf irgendwelche Adressen. Grüße Bernard
  6. Bernard

    TIA S7 1200 SCL Array of TON

    Hallo an alle, habe vor geraumer Zeit einmal eine Methode gezeigt wie man in SCL ein Array of FB proggen kann. Lieder ist diese Methode nur auf Klassik S7 Anwendbar, da das Tia Portal andere Compiler verwendet. Das man für diese Methode leistungsstarke SPSen braucht erklärt sich von selbst...
  7. Bernard

    Step 7 Kommunikation S7 3xx/4xx mit 224 über MPI

    Kommunikation S7 3xx/4xx mit 224 über MPI Die S7-200 kann auf dem MPI-Bus als Slave verwendet werden. Von der S7,400-300er, Seite kann dann mittels der Bausteine SFB67(X_Get), SFB68(X_PUT) auf die S7-200 zugegriffen werden. Der Zugriff erfolgt innerhalb der S7-200 im Datenbausteinbereiches...
  8. Bernard

    Step 7 Multiinstanzen

    Hallo Leute , Wenn man die Typprüfung abschaltet, dann nimmt es das Entwicklungssystem, doch was dann in der Steuerung daraus wird, will ich nicht wissen. ein Abschalten der Typenprüfung ändert nichts an der multiinstanzfähigkeit eines FBs. Die einzigen,mir bekannten, Siemens-FBs die nie...
  9. Bernard

    S7 1200 Zykluszeit

    Hallo dentech, anbei ein gezipptes Projekt mit einer 1212 AC/DC/Relay Version2.2. Dort wird im OB1 errechnet welche Zykluszeit für den OB1 ab dem zweiten Zyklus ansteht. Die SPS holt sich aus den Internet über das NTP Verfahren die aktuelle Zeit(siehe Hardware Konfig), aus dieser Sytemzeit...
  10. Bernard

    Bei Ausfall vom MP277 die Handbedienung zurücksetzen (OB 86?)

    Was ist denn daran Kompliziert. Es muß nur die HW geändert werden und etwas im OB86 geproggt werden.Vieleicht sollten sich einige Leute daran gewöhnen das es meistens mehr als zwei Wege gibt und nicht nur der eigene sinnvoll ist.
  11. Bernard

    Bei Ausfall vom MP277 die Handbedienung zurücksetzen (OB 86?)

    Doch das geht siehe Wincc-Flex Hilfe, Konfiguration von Profibus DP Direkttasten. Gruß Bernard
  12. Bernard

    Ersatz für SFC83/SFC84

    Ersatz sfc83/84 Hallo, der sfc 20 wäre ein Ersatz für sfc83/84. Allerdings kann der SFC20 durch höherpriore Alarme unterbrochen werden. Mir sfc39 lassen sich entsprechende Alarme sperren und mit sfc40 wieder freigeben. viele Grüße Bernard
  13. Bernard

    Aus Word BITs rausziehen

    Bit aus Byte guten Abend, schau mal hier. http://www.sps-forum.de/showthread.php?t=32871&page=2 viele Grüße Bernard
  14. Bernard

    Daten Übertragung

    Bit in MW das zweite bit im Mw22 ist M 23.1. die Bytes müssen gedreht werden,oder vlt. kann man beim slave in der HW-Konfig über die Eigenschaften von Little Endian auf Big Endian umschalten. Hier nochmal der Code für dein Programm in einem Netzwerk in AWL l ew3 // little Endian...
  15. Bernard

    Daten Übertragung

    Standard Merkerwörter übertragen Hallo, es sieht so aus als ob dein Messsystem mit Little Endian arbeitet. füge mal folgende Codezeilen ein. l "messwert_vom System" // litte Endian z.B.MW40 taw // tauschen der Bytes t "umgeformter_Wert" // Big Endian...
Zurück
Oben